Chinese Students Become Largest Overseas Contingent At U.S. Universities

The overall Asian presence on this year's "Open Doors" list by IIE is striking, with the top three sending countries -- China, India and South Korea -- accounting for nearly half (44%) of all international enrollments at American universities.
